ERA-40 Print E-mail

The European Centre for Medium-Range Weather Forecasts (ECMWF) has produced ERA-40, a 45 year re-analysis covering the period September 1957 to August 2002. The ERA-40 data were produced at a resolution of T159/N80/L60 extending from the ground to 0.1hPa. The assimilation system uses 3D-VAR while the forecasting model is based on an operational model from around the year 2000. Additional documentation on ERA-40 can be found from the British Atmospheric Data Centre (BADC), and the ECMWF.

NCAS-Climate ERA-40 data

NCAS-Climate has extracted a subset of the ERA-40 data to produce a dataset that contains analyses on various level types, with some forecasts of surface fields. The data are archived at full resolution. Model level data are available to the NCAS community in GRIB format on HECToR, whilst other level types are available to local users in the Department of Meteorology, University of Reading in NetCDF format.

NCAS-Climate ERA-40 NetCDF data

  • These data are held on charney where they are available to local users in the Department of Meteorology, University of Reading
  • These data comprise six hourly analyses at the surface and on pressure, isentropic and PV=2PVU levels.
  • The (daily) forecast data is confined to a few fields at the surface.
  • The GRIB data was converted to NetCDF using XCONV.
  • In addition, monthly mean fields are being produced from the NetCDF data using the nco utilities.
  • Monthly climatologies and interannual variability for the years 1957 to 2002 have been produced from the monthly mean data.
